From nobody Mon Mar 4 19:51:04 2024 X-Original-To: ports-bugs@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4TpTpK0pgZz5DBZT for ; Mon, 4 Mar 2024 19:51:05 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4TpTpJ5KvHz4hnm for ; Mon, 4 Mar 2024 19:51:04 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1709581864; a=rsa-sha256; cv=none; b=gk/jlD2fS7de2XZMpYYVoTu5adXAqVpp2D961Vx+cja07NH77pvZrOexWA9NCEcCUdc/w8 AnKTKYpKhxf7mG9YrbpOZsnBkMSPvRSbqUeamjYuqEoQ53C2SVWoHFcbabTBepgI7r/DyZ xeD0eF7r8AW731YUG5CYkekUwdAOZ4suPiFJJrAhwaSbHRL1+Ggdv3HykdsfRRvmnEZo0p azykATgwryJBj5yF6Jzq7sZ+t/tLgwIMlZUtfDFbffC5B7e8lpB4Fy18Uy3ZGTwosjMPdE 5WbBMde1Mu2gygmO1A2hZ50Os38v8DXWALUdByKjud6d3dgrMJubSR/65niYjQ==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1709581864;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=4bhsXpvC4jYhAdA1WXb9BojqJSBqhCuMqr27KWc9hcg=; b=pM3vMhx0qmq5LItxJKxqcrodiUq24sO48U8S0ZYKJ0HaMOb0auzCTJnCjmfSXPt/inRSw5 xpveDpQqCTMjWIxU1d/vxUxd2fUD3OUFso6YT0ta/49VaLnS0dW0CWHbtgQ1s97ZcpScd5 Tq0Xx1hN8Lsad8EedL4sillSrnXI3ytnka5cqQPluLMGPlHlu3NFEM7vt51mvXZhiO6fCO ajMXkaOR4kc0beSJwV/6grQ/0Z0juSKHL4QepN8IE+4ESO+9rIymhAgAhfr0YvjERnLZij rQnW3WQmb+2+22mK8ZLRj4qlAQjrkEYkApBxew04pfgoZl1MJp1akJ7DcReJdQ==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2610:1c1:1:606c::50:1d]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4TpTpJ4pFMzbJ0 for ; Mon, 4 Mar 2024 19:51:04 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from kenobi.freebsd.org ([127.0.1.5]) by kenobi.freebsd.org (8.15.2/8.15.2) with ESMTP id 424Jp4kq050355 for ; Mon, 4 Mar 2024 19:51:04 GMT (envelope-from bugzilla-noreply@freebsd.org) Received: (from www@localhost) by kenobi.freebsd.org (8.15.2/8.15.2/Submit) id 424Jp4LE050354 for ports-bugs@FreeBSD.org; Mon, 4 Mar 2024 19:51:04 GMT (envelope-from bugzilla-noreply@freebsd.org) X-Authentication-Warning: kenobi.freebsd.org: www set sender to bugzilla-noreply@freebsd.org using -f From: bugzilla-noreply@freebsd.org To: ports-bugs@FreeBSD.org Subject: [Bug 275190] www/owncast: Update to 0.1.2 Date: Mon, 04 Mar 2024 19:51:04 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Ports & Packages X-Bugzilla-Component: Individual Port(s) X-Bugzilla-Version: Latest X-Bugzilla-Keywords: needs-patch X-Bugzilla-Severity: Affects Only Me X-Bugzilla-Who: dch@freebsd.org X-Bugzilla-Status: New X-Bugzilla-Resolution: X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: ports-bugs@FreeBSD.org X-Bugzilla-Flags: maintainer-feedback? X-Bugzilla-Changed-Fields: cc flagtypes.name attachments.created Message-ID: In-Reply-To: References: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ated List-Id: Ports bug reports List-Archive: https://lists.freebsd.org/archives/freebsd-ports-bugs List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-ports-bugs@freebsd.org X-BeenThere: freebsd-ports-bugs@freebsd.org MIME-Version: 1.0 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D275190 Dave Cottlehuber chang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|dch@freebsd.org Attachment #248932| |maintainer-approval?(de-fre Flags| |ebsd@ctseuro.com) --- Comment #3 from Dave Cottlehuber --- Created attachment 248932 --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=3D248932&action= =3Dedit naive patch that seems to work As I don't use owncast at all, I can't really comment if the patch is appropriate and complete, but: - it builds on amd64 14.0-RELEASE in poudriere - with `chown -R owncast:owncast /var/db/owncast` and rc.conf owncast_enable=3DYES owncast_path=3D/var/db/owncast - it seems to start up and the admin panel works on localhost:8080/admin I expect the pkg-plist could be trimmed, and the r/w directories currently under /usr/local/www/owncast should be cleaned up such that it's readonly by default, and the writable directories should live in a more usual place, IMO. Perhaps impacted users can comment on the usefulness of the patch, and if all of the files under /usrlocal/www/owncast are needed anymore? I would expect go to embed many of these files in the binary. --=20 You are receiving this mail because: You are the assignee for the bug.=